MOSCOW, October 3 (RIA Novosti) - The State Duma adopted legal amendments on Friday paving the way for Russia's Central Bank to issue unsecured loans for up to six months to rated Russian banks.

The amendments are part of efforts to stabilize the country's financial sector amid the current global financial crisis.

The amendments will allow the Central Bank to issue loans under terms and conditions set by its boards of directors.
